Let’s hear it for the atLarge newbies

newbies blog1 Lets hear it for the atLarge newbies

We’ve been growing again. As you can imagine it takes lots of talent and brains to keep atLarge projects in check. And here are the newest peeps making it happen!

Matt – The Mad Scientist

His enthusiasm and devotion to all things code make Matt one of our brightest up-and-coming atLargers. When he’s not programming, he’s making music. This guitar-toting, trumpet-swinging musician not only plays–he writes and records his very own tunes. Matt also knows his way around gaming. While chasing his computer science degree at Florida State University he co-created Project Timerol–a role-playing game where you slay alien invaders.

Ellen - The Straightener

She’s a multi-tasking perfectionist that can straighten out everything from the books to customer care. This dog lover has lived (albeit out of a suitcase in some cases) in Arizona, California, Georgia, Massachusetts, Oregon, Washington and Wyoming as part of the integration team that took her last company from $8 million to $250 million in sales. Now, you wouldn’t guess it by looking at this petite powerhouse but Ellen’s happiest when she’s riding a motorcycle. Her favorite? The Jesse Rooke Scrambler.

Devin - The Connector

Creatives love her organizational prowess, clients dig her business savvy and all fancy her calm under pressure vibe. These are just a few of the traits that took Devin’s college team all the way to Microsoft Studios where they pitched their engagement campaign for a leading Kinect game. The Ringling College of Art and Design grad also finagled her way into co-producing episodes for the All Ringling Television Network (ART Network) while pursuing her business of art and design degree. So what does this overachiever do when she’s not leading projects? You’ll find this New York native making stuff. She loves to crochet, paint, draw and photograph. Oh, and she shows no mercy at Monopoly or Double Solitaire. You’ve been warned.
